Process for Obtaining a Driving License in Denmark

  1. Eligibility Check: Ensure you fulfill the age and residency requirements.
  2. Theoretical Exam: Pass a theoretical understanding test covering traffic rules and guidelines.
  3. Practical Driving Test: Successfully complete a practical driving test with an approved inspector.
  4. Medical checkup: Provide a medical declaration validating your physical and psychological fitness.
  5. Application Submission: Submit your application together with necessary files to the regional municipality.
  6. License Issuance: Upon passing the tests and fulfilling all requirements, you will get your Danish driving license.

Actions to Obtain a Business License

  1. Select a Business Structure: Decide whether you will run as a sole proprietor, collaboration, or corporation.
  2. Register the Business: Submit the needed files to the Danish Business Authority, including your organization plan.
  3. Acquire Necessary Permits: Acquire all needed licenses depending on your service activities (e.g., food handling, health and wellness).
  4. Tax Registration: Register for VAT and get a tax identification number.
  5. Compliance with Regulations: Ensure that your organization complies with local laws and policies.

Actions to Obtain a Professional License

  1. Education Verification: Validate your educational certifications through the relevant authority.
  2. Language Requirements: Demonstrate efficiency in Danish, particularly in particular sectors like healthcare and law.
  3. Internship: Complete an internship or residency where applicable, particularly in the medical and legal fields.
  4. Evaluation: Pass any examinations required for your occupation.
  5. Application Submission: Submit your application to the appropriate licensing authority together with supporting documents.
